fix nightly clippy

This commit is contained in:
extrawurst 2024-03-24 12:50:56 -07:00
parent 76814a36e3
commit 9c8c802b20
5 changed files with 1 additions and 17 deletions

View File

@ -148,12 +148,9 @@ impl ChangesComponent {
fn dispatch_reset_workdir(&mut self) -> bool {
if let Some(tree_item) = self.selection() {
let is_folder =
matches!(tree_item.kind, FileTreeItemKind::Path(_));
self.queue.push(InternalEvent::ConfirmAction(
Action::Reset(ResetItem {
path: tree_item.info.full_path,
is_folder,
}),
));

View File

@ -617,7 +617,6 @@ impl DiffComponent {
self.queue.push(InternalEvent::ConfirmAction(Action::Reset(
ResetItem {
path: self.current.path.clone(),
is_folder: false,
},
)));
}

View File

@ -100,11 +100,6 @@ impl RevisionFilesComponent {
self.revision.as_ref()
}
///
pub const fn selection(&self) -> Option<usize> {
self.tree.selection()
}
///
pub fn update(&mut self, ev: AsyncNotification) -> Result<()> {
self.current_file.update(ev);

View File

@ -18,15 +18,11 @@ use std::path::Path;
#[derive(Clone, Debug)]
pub struct FileTreeOpen {
pub commit_id: CommitId,
pub selection: Option<usize>,
}
impl FileTreeOpen {
pub const fn new(commit_id: CommitId) -> Self {
Self {
commit_id,
selection: None,
}
Self { commit_id }
}
}
@ -81,7 +77,6 @@ impl RevisionFilesPopup {
self.queue.push(InternalEvent::PopupStackPush(
StackablePopupOpen::FileTree(FileTreeOpen {
commit_id: revision.id,
selection: self.files.selection(),
}),
));
}

View File

@ -35,8 +35,6 @@ bitflags! {
pub struct ResetItem {
/// path to the item (folder/file)
pub path: String,
/// are talking about a folder here? otherwise it's a single file
pub is_folder: bool,
}
///